The Role of Signal Flags and Banners in Medieval Battlefield Communication

In medieval warfare, signal flags and banners served as vital tools for battlefield communication, conveying strategic commands swiftly across distances. They allowed commanders to issue orders, coordinate troop movements, and rally forces without direct verbal communication.

These visual signals were often distinct in color, design, and heraldic symbols, making them easily recognizable amidst the chaos of battle. Banners represented different factions or units, fostering unity and aiding in the identification of allies and adversaries.

Moreover, the strategic placement of banners and flags at vantage points enhanced their visibility, ensuring messages reached subordinate units efficiently. This method played a crucial role in maintaining command and control during the turmoil of medieval battles. The effective use of signal flags and banners exemplifies the importance of visual signaling techniques in medieval battlefield communication methods.

Messenger Systems and the Use of Couriers in Medieval Warfare

Messenger systems and the use of couriers played a vital role in medieval warfare, serving as the primary means of rapid communication across battlefield and territory. These couriers transported crucial messages, orders, and intelligence between commanders and troops.

Couriers often traveled on foot, horseback, or by carriage, navigating challenging terrains to ensure swift delivery. Their mobility was essential for maintaining strategic coordination during battles or sieges, especially where visual signals or auditory methods were impractical.

To enhance security, messages were sometimes coded or concealed within personal belongings, reducing the risk of interception by enemies. The reliability of these messenger systems depended heavily on the couriers’ loyalty, stamina, and knowledge of the terrain. This system underscored the importance of trustworthy personnel in executing battlefield communication effectively.

The Significance of Horns, Trumpets, and Drums for Tactical Announcements

Horns, trumpets, and drums served as vital communication tools in medieval warfare, especially for tactical announcements. Their loud, distinct sounds could carry across battlefield terrains, ensuring messages reached troops promptly despite environmental challenges.

These instruments conveyed critical commands, such as advancing, retreating, or regrouping, enabling commanders to coordinate large armies effectively. Sound signals minimized confusion and maintained battlefield discipline during chaotic encounters.

The use of such communication methods employed standardized signals, with specific tones or rhythms representing different instructions. Common practices included:

  • Trumpets signaling troop movements or phases of battle
  • Horns used for long-distance calls or alerts
  • Drums emphasizing urgency or rhythm for coordinated actions

Challenges of Voice Communication on the Battlefield

Voice communication on the medieval battlefield presented significant challenges due to technological limitations. Loud environments, such as clashes of armor and weapons, often muffled or drowned out spoken commands, reducing clarity and precision.

The chaos and noise made it difficult for commanders to rely solely on voice signals, risking miscommunication with troops. Distance also played a critical role; shouting was ineffective over large distances, especially without the modern amplification tools.

Environmental factors, including wind, rain, and terrain, further hindered clarity and audibility. These conditions could distort or disperse sound waves, making verbal communication unreliable during critical moments.

Overall, these challenges underscored the importance of supplementary visual and auditory signaling methods in medieval warfare, which helped overcome the limitations of direct voice communication.

Limitations and Security Concerns of Medieval Communication Methods

Medieval communication methods faced significant limitations due to technological constraints and environmental factors. Visual signals like banners, flags, and signal fires could be obscured by weather, terrain, or darkness, hampering message clarity and timely transmission.

Additionally, these methods were vulnerable to misinterpretation or deliberate deception. Enemies could intercept signals, forge false messages, or disrupt communication, creating confusion and lowering battlefield coordination effectiveness.

The security concerns were further compounded by the reliance on messengers and couriers. Couriers were susceptible to capture, interception, or betrayal, risking the exposure of vital strategic information. Their safety depended heavily on escort quality and the prevailing security environment.

Overall, the limitations and security concerns of medieval communication methods underscored the demands for more reliable, secure, and rapid communication strategies, which remained a challenge until technological advancements in later centuries.
